Book on Rani Laxmibai banned in Uttar Pradesh
Lucknow: The Uttar Pradesh government has banned a book on Rani Laxmibai, better known as Jhansi ki Rani, for allegedly objectionable content.The book titled "Rani", authored by Jaishree Misra and published by Penguin, was alleged to be containing highly objectionable material relating to her personal life.The government made the announcement on the floor of the assembly after the issue was raised by Congress Legislature Party leader Pramod Tiwari and his party colleague from Jhansi, Pradeep Jain.The two leaders termed the contents of the book as "an insult to the iron lady who took on the British with unparalleled courage and gave tremendous strength to the country's freedom movement".Rani Laxmibai is hailed as one of the country's leading freedom fighters who stood up against the British in India's first war of independence in 1857.Source: Indo-Asian News Service
